/**
|
||||
* OfferPie Web 前端蓝绿部署流水线
|
||||
*
|
||||
* 工作目录说明:
|
||||
* - Jenkins 会自动为每个项目创建独立的工作空间:/var/jenkins_home/workspace/<项目名>/
|
||||
* - docker-compose.yml、Dockerfile、nginx.conf 都在项目根目录,直接执行即可
|
||||
* - nginx.conf 首次部署时 docker cp 进 nginx 容器
|
||||
*
|
||||
* 内层 Nginx 职责:
|
||||
* - 蓝绿切换(前端静态文件 serve)
|
||||
* - /api/ 代理到 Java 后端(10202)
|
||||
* - /ai-api/ 代理到 Python AI(10502),rewrite 去掉前缀
|
||||
*/
|
||||
pipeline {
|
||||
agent any
|
||||
|
||||
parameters {
|
||||
choice(name: 'BRANCH', choices: ['master', 'pre', 'dev', 'test'], description: '选择要部署的分支')
|
||||
}
|
||||
|
||||
environment {
|
||||
CONTAINER_PREFIX = 'offerpie-web' // 容器名前缀,拼接 -blue / -green / -nginx
|
||||
HEALTH_URL = 'http://localhost/' // 前端静态页面健康检查
|
||||
}
|
||||
|
||||
stages {
|
||||
stage('开始提示') {
|
||||
steps {
|
||||
echo "OfferPie Web 前端开始构建"
|
||||
}
|
||||
}
|
||||
|
||||
stage('拉取代码') {
|
||||
steps {
|
||||
echo "拉取 ${params.BRANCH} 分支代码"
|
||||
git branch: "${params.BRANCH}",
|
||||
credentialsId: 'ef5fffc1-9b35-403d-9ca6-e1b73eb0e45a',
|
||||
url: 'https://codeup.aliyun.com/5f0ed3b9769820a3e817dee2/offerpie/offerpie_web.git'
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 检测部署目标
|
||||
* - 检查 blue 和 green 容器的运行状态
|
||||
* - blue 在运行 → 部署 green;green 在运行 → 部署 blue
|
||||
* - 都不在或都在 → 默认部署 blue
|
||||
*/
|
||||
stage('检测部署目标') {
|
||||
steps {
|
||||
echo "检查当前容器状态"
|
||||
script {
|
||||
def blueRunning = sh(script: "docker ps -q -f name=${CONTAINER_PREFIX}-blue", returnStdout: true).trim()
|
||||
def greenRunning = sh(script: "docker ps -q -f name=${CONTAINER_PREFIX}-green", returnStdout: true).trim()
|
||||
|
||||
env.DEPLOY_TARGET = ''
|
||||
|
||||
if (blueRunning && !greenRunning) {
|
||||
env.DEPLOY_TARGET = 'green'
|
||||
}
|
||||
if (greenRunning && !blueRunning) {
|
||||
env.DEPLOY_TARGET = 'blue'
|
||||
}
|
||||
if (!env.DEPLOY_TARGET) {
|
||||
echo "当前环境未部署服务或状态异常,默认部署 blue"
|
||||
env.DEPLOY_TARGET = 'blue'
|
||||
}
|
||||
|
||||
env.OTHER_TARGET = (env.DEPLOY_TARGET == 'blue') ? 'green' : 'blue'
|
||||
echo "当前激活: ${env.OTHER_TARGET},即将部署: ${env.DEPLOY_TARGET}"
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 构建新版本
|
||||
* - 先清理目标颜色的旧容器(如果残留)
|
||||
* - docker-compose build 构建新镜像(含 pnpm build)
|
||||
*/
|
||||
stage('构建新版本') {
|
||||
steps {
|
||||
script {
|
||||
def existingContainer = sh(script: "docker ps -aq -f name=${CONTAINER_PREFIX}-${env.DEPLOY_TARGET}", returnStdout: true).trim()
|
||||
if (existingContainer) {
|
||||
echo "清理已存在的容器: ${CONTAINER_PREFIX}-${env.DEPLOY_TARGET}"
|
||||
sh "docker rm -f ${CONTAINER_PREFIX}-${env.DEPLOY_TARGET}"
|
||||
}
|
||||
sh "docker-compose build ${env.DEPLOY_TARGET}"
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 检查 Nginx
|
||||
* - 检查 nginx 容器是否存在
|
||||
* - 不存在则启动并复制配置文件(首次部署)
|
||||
* - 存在则确保容器运行中
|
||||
*/
|
||||
stage('检查Nginx') {
|
||||
steps {
|
||||
script {
|
||||
def nginxExists = sh(script: "docker ps -aq -f name=${CONTAINER_PREFIX}-nginx", returnStdout: true).trim()
|
||||
if (!nginxExists) {
|
||||
echo "首次部署,初始化 Nginx 容器"
|
||||
sh "docker-compose up -d nginx"
|
||||
sh "sleep 3"
|
||||
// 复制配置文件到容器内
|
||||
sh "docker cp proxy_nginx.conf ${CONTAINER_PREFIX}-nginx:/etc/nginx/nginx.conf"
|
||||
sh "docker exec ${CONTAINER_PREFIX}-nginx nginx -s reload"
|
||||
} else {
|
||||
def nginxRunning = sh(script: "docker ps -q -f name=${CONTAINER_PREFIX}-nginx", returnStdout: true).trim()
|
||||
if (!nginxRunning) {
|
||||
echo "Nginx 容器已停止,重新启动"
|
||||
sh "docker start ${CONTAINER_PREFIX}-nginx"
|
||||
sh "sleep 2"
|
||||
}
|
||||
echo "Nginx 容器已存在且运行中"
|
||||
}
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
stage('启动新版本') {
|
||||
steps {
|
||||
script {
|
||||
sh "docker-compose up -d ${env.DEPLOY_TARGET}"
|
||||
// 等待 Nginx 容器启动
|
||||
sh 'sleep 5'
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 健康检查
|
||||
* - 进入容器检测静态页面是否正常返回
|
||||
* - 最多重试 3 次,每次间隔 5 秒
|
||||
* - 全部失败则终止部署流程
|
||||
*/
|
||||
stage('健康检查') {
|
||||
steps {
|
||||
script {
|
||||
def maxRetries = 3
|
||||
def retryCount = 0
|
||||
def healthy = false
|
||||
|
||||
while (retryCount < maxRetries && !healthy) {
|
||||
try {
|
||||
sh "docker exec ${CONTAINER_PREFIX}-${env.DEPLOY_TARGET} wget --spider -q ${HEALTH_URL}"
|
||||
healthy = true
|
||||
} catch (Exception e) {
|
||||
retryCount++
|
||||
if (retryCount < maxRetries) {
|
||||
echo "健康检查失败,5秒后重试 (${retryCount}/${maxRetries})"
|
||||
sleep 5
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
if (!healthy) {
|
||||
error "健康检查失败,部署中止"
|
||||
}
|
||||
echo "✅ ${CONTAINER_PREFIX}-${env.DEPLOY_TARGET} 健康检查通过"
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 切换流量
|
||||
* - 修改 nginx 配置中的 proxy_pass 指向新版本
|
||||
* - nginx 不挂载宿主机文件,直接 sed -i 修改容器内配置
|
||||
* - reload 使新配置生效,实现零停机切换
|
||||
*/
|
||||
stage('切换流量') {
|
||||
steps {
|
||||
script {
|
||||
sh "docker exec ${CONTAINER_PREFIX}-nginx sed -i 's/proxy_pass http:\\/\\/\\(blue\\|green\\);/proxy_pass http:\\/\\/${env.DEPLOY_TARGET};/' /etc/nginx/nginx.conf"
|
||||
sh "docker exec ${CONTAINER_PREFIX}-nginx nginx -s reload"
|
||||
echo "✅ 流量已切换到 ${env.DEPLOY_TARGET}"
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* 停止并删除旧版本
|
||||
* - 不能用 docker-compose down,会删除所有服务(包括 nginx)
|
||||
* - 用 docker rm -f 只删除指定的旧颜色容器
|
||||
*/
|
||||
stage('删除旧版本') {
|
||||
steps {
|
||||
script {
|
||||
def otherExists = sh(script: "docker ps -aq -f name=${CONTAINER_PREFIX}-${env.OTHER_TARGET}", returnStdout: true).trim()
|
||||
if (otherExists) {
|
||||
sh "docker rm -f ${CONTAINER_PREFIX}-${env.OTHER_TARGET}"
|
||||
echo "旧版本 ${env.OTHER_TARGET} 已删除"
|
||||
}
|
||||
}
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
post {
|
||||
success {
|
||||
echo "✅ 蓝绿部署成功!当前运行: ${env.DEPLOY_TARGET}"
|
||||
}
|
||||
failure {
|
||||
echo '❌ 部署失败,请检查日志'
|
||||
}
|
||||
}
|
||||
}
